Multiple variations for a single listing

I would like to list a single item at a time that has two different variations boxes to choose from With 7 different extras to choose from per variation. However when I do this it shows a large quantity when I only want to have one item listed at a time. Is this possible, been messing with it for a while now and just cannot figure it out. 😞 My brain is basically cooked tonight so maybe I'm just missing something simple... So it would be one item for sale then the buyer could drop down the variation box 1 and select 1 of 7 different items to go with it and then drop box 2 and select 1 of 7 different items to go with it. That's what I'd like to do anyways. Thanks for any info!

Sounds like you just have 14 different combinations then, right? No problem. Create 1 "attribute" and label it like "box". Under that attribute, create two "options" labeling them like #1 then #2. That covers your boxes.

 

Now create another attribute calling it like "extras". Then create 7 options under that attribute (and numbering them 1-7). Click save and ebay will ask you if you want it to like populate your variations automatically. Click yes.

 

Make sure you put quantity 1 for each variation you created. It will ultimately add up to 14. Viola, you're done. When a buyer clicks into your listing but doesn't choose a variation yet, they will see qty 14. It will change to qty 1 after they made the choice.

 

That's no different than how I make my listings with 2 colors and 7 sizes each color.

The variations format can't be set up to offer just one item.   There has to be a quantity available for each combination, even if some of them are zero. It's meant to be used for manufactured items, such as clothing that comes in multiple sizes and colors.
